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Choosing Baby Receiving Blankets

  1. Material and skin sensitivity: Choose 100% cotton flannel for softness or bamboo/cotton muslin blends for breathability and quick drying. Consider OEKO-TEX Standard 100 compliance for extra reassurance.
  2. Size and versatility: Typical sizes range from 28×28 inches to 30×30 inches for receiving swaddles and general use. Larger muslin blankets can double as nursing covers or sunshades.
  3. Care and durability: Look for blankets that withstand regular wash cycles without shrinking or pilling. Pre-washed fabrics tend to feel softer sooner.
  4. Number of pieces: Bundles offer better value and consistency. Consider whether you need multiple blankets for daycare, travel, or nursery backup.
  5. Breathability vs warmth: Flannel provides warmth and softness; muslin blends offer breathability and light coverage. Match to season and climate.
  6. Design and stain resistance: Subtle patterns may hide minor stains; solid colors simplify coordination with outfits and gear.

FAQ: Quick Answers For Buyers

  1. What size should I look for in receiving blankets? Most look for 30×30 inches for swaddling and everyday use; 28×28 inches can be compact for travel.
  2. Are muslin blankets better than flannel? Muslin is typically more breathable and fast-drying; flannel is softer and warmer for cooler days. Each serves different needs.
  3. How many blankets do I need? A practical starter set is 4–6 blankets to cover daily changes, while a larger family may want 7–12 for daycare and travel.
  4. Is 100% cotton necessary? Cotton offers softness and washability; blends can improve breathability and durability depending on the blend.
  5. Can receiving blankets be used beyond swaddling? Yes, they work as burp cloths, nursing covers, stroller sunshades, and play mats.
  6. Should I avoid any materials? Avoid fabrics with harsh dyes or irritants for newborns; look for gentle, baby-safe finishes.
